Santander, Puerto Deportivo, Marismas Blancas, Barrio la Raba, travelling to Fuente de and at Fuente de.

A day along the coast and then into the mountains.

After a very nice breakfast at the Hotel Chiqui we had a walk along the sea front seeing the Common Terns (Charrán Común / Sterna hirudo), Yellow-legged (Gaviota Patiamarilla / Larus Michahellis) and Mediterranean Gulls (Gaviota Cabecinegra / Larus melanocephalus), Shag (Cormorán Mondudo / Phalacrocorax aristotelis), Goldfinch (Jilguero / Carduelis carduelis), Spotless Starling (Estornino Negro / Sturnus unicolor), Blackbird (Mirlo Común / Turdus merula), House Sparrow (Gorrión Común / Passer domesticus) and Wren (Chochin / Troglodytes troglodytes).

We headed just along the coast where we checked out some pools along side the runways of the Santander Airport, on the smaller pool we had a pair of Mute Swans (Cisne Vulgar / Cygnus olor), one of which was sat on a nest, Mallard (Anade Azulón / Anas platyrhynchos), Common Pochard (Porrón Común / Aythya ferina), Little Grebe (Zampullín Común / Tachybaptus ruficollis), Eurasian Coot (Focha Común / Fulica atra), a female type Marsh Harrier (Aguilucho Lagunero Occidental / Circus aeruginosus) which was carrying prey, House Martin (Avión Común / Delichon urbica), Reed (Carricero Común / Acrocephalus scrpaceus) and Cetti's Warbler (Ruisenor Bastardo / Cettia cetti).

On the Causeway between the two Pools we had a Common Magpie (Urraca / Pica pica) and several Spotless Starlings (Estornino Negro / Sturnus unicolor). On the second bigger lagoon there was a group of summer plumaged Dunlin (Correlimos Común / Calidris alpina), 3x Common Redshank (Archibebe Común / Tringa totanus), Little Ringed Plover (Chorlitejo Chico / Charadrius dubius), a single Ruddy Turnstone (Vuelvepiedras Común / Arenaria interpres), a couple more Mute Swans, Black-headed Gull (Gaviota Riedora / Larus ridibundus), 3x Little Egrets (Garceta Común / Egreeta garzetta) and right down at the far end of the pool singles of Common and Gull-billed Terns (Pagaza Piconegra / Gelochelidon nilotica), a young Red Fox (Zorro / Vulpus vulpus) on the far bank amonst the reeds, Barn Swallow (Golondrina Común / Hirundo rustica), Common Swift (Vencejo Común / Apus apus), a fly over Black Kite (Milano Negro / Milvus migrans) and as we walked back to Van a male Reed Bunting (Escribano Palustre / Emberiza schoeniclus) flew passed us and out into the reeds.

We moved on down the road to the port where we parked and checked the perimeter fence adding Corn Bunting (Triguero / Emberiza calandra), a family of Black Redstarts (Colirrojo Tizón / Phoenicurus ochruros) and in an area of grass Green-veined White (Pieris napi), Geranium Bronze (Cacyreus marshalli), Small Heath (Coenonympha pamphilus), Small White (Pieris rapae), Perez's Frog (Rana Común / Pelophylax perezi) and as we walked over to the waters edge and scanned the Estuary an Western Osprey (Águila Pescardora / Pandion haliaetus) flew over head scattering all the Common Terns

We jumped back on to the motorway but were soon off again at a freshwater pool and tidal lagoon called Las Marismas Blancas where we had a look at the largest of the lakes and saw a pair of Mute Swans with four cignets, more Mallards, Common Pochards, Gadwall (Anade Friso / Anas strepera), a surprising male Tufted Duck (Porrón Monudo / Aythya fuligula) which is normally only a winter visitor, Little Grebe, Eurasian Coot, plenty of Western Cattle Egrets (Garcilla Bueyera / Bubulcus ibis) flying in to the reedbeds and whilst I waited by the van the others went to have a walk around the rest of the reserve but they did not pick up much new.

Whilst I was waiting I picked up Black Kite (Milano Negro / Milvus migrans), Common Kestrel (Cernicalo Vulgar / Falco tinnunculus), Great Cormorant (Cormorán Grande / Phalacrocroax carbo), Carrion Crow (Corneja Negra / Corvus corone), Great Tit (Carbonera Común / Parus major), Glossy Ibis (Morito Común / Plegadis falcinellus), Blue / Southern Hawker (Aeshna cyanea), Lesser Emperor (Anax parthenope), Speckled Wood (Pararge aegeria), Clouded Yellow (Colias Común / Colias corcea), Common Mallow (Malva sylvestris), Ragged Robin (Lychnis flos-cuculi), Scarlet Pimpernel (Anagallis arvensis), Yarrow (Achillea millefolium), Musk Mallow (Malva moschata), White Clover (Trifolium repens), Red Clover (Trifolium pratense), Self heal (Prunella vulgaris) and Tufted Vetch (Vicia cracca).

Once the others returned we had a female Red-crested Pochard (Pato Colorado / Netta rufina) out amongst the Eurasian Coots, four Black-winged Stilt (Ciguenela Común / Himantopus himantopus) which flew in and over the road on the tidal part of the area we we saw more Common Terns and a summer plumaged Black-tailed Godwit (Aguja Colinegra / Limosa limosa) which flew in.

We again moved on around the estuary where we had a walk along a track on the southern shore, in the sky above us we had a group of Black Kites with a Peregrine Falcon (Halcón Peregrino / Falco peregrinus) soaring with them.

As we walked we also had Little Egret, Blackcap (Curruca Capirotada / Sylvia atricailla), Wren (Chochin / Troglodytes troglodytes), Black-headed Gull, Carrion Crow, Common Buzzard (Busardo Ratonero / Buteo buteo), Song Thrush (Zorzal Común / Turdus philomelos), Serin (Verdecillo / Serinus serinus), Robin (Petirrojo Europeo / Erithacus rubecula), Great Tit, a singing Melodious Warbler (Zarcero Común / Hippolais polyglotta) and way out on the estuary Shag and a pair of Great Crested Grebes (Somormujo Lavanco / Podiceps cristatus).

We started our drive out towards Fuente De with Bob seeing a Grey Heron (Garza Real / Ardea cinerea) from the van, we stopping for some lunch in Unquera seeing Barn Swallow, House Martin, Common Swift, Common Magpie (Urraca / Pica pica), White Wagtail (Lavandera Blanca / Montacilla alba) and Mallards.

As we dropped south we made a stop along the Rio Deva and found Mouflon (Ovis orientalis), Griffon (Bultre Leonado / Gyps fulvus) and Egyptian Vulture (Alimoche Común / Neophron percnopterus), Woodpigeon (Paloma Torcaz / Columba palumbus), Raven (Cuervo / Corvus corax), Song Thrush, Grey Wagtail and Blackcap (Curruca Capirotada / Sylvia atricailla).

Once we were through Potes we made another stop and found an Immature Dipper (Mirlo Acuático / Cinclus cinclus) further on along the Rio Deva.

We arrived at the Hotel in Fuente de and checked in, later we went for a walk across the meadows at the back and down the spring that I am guessing is the beginning of the Deva, on the fields we found Field Eryngium (Eryngium campestre), Purple Bugloss (Echium plantagineum), Small Tortoiseshell (Aglais urticae) and a stunning male Red-backed Shrike (Alcaudón Dorsirrojo / Lanius collurio) which showed well for us.

On a back as we walked towards the woods we had Purple Gromwell (Lithospermum purpurocaeruleum), Mediterranean Kidney Vetch (Anthyllis vulneraria), Pyrenean Germander (Teucrium pyrenaicum), Rabbits bread (Andryala integrifolia), Yellow Rockrose (Helianthemum nummularium) and Man Orchid (Orchis anthropophora).

In the woodlands we had  Speckled Wood, Comma (Polygonum c-album), Brimstone (Gonepteryx rhamni), Cleopatra (Cleopatra / Gonepteryx cleopatra), Nottingham Catchfly (Silene nutans), Wild Carrot (Daucus carota), Wild Strawberry (Fragaria vesca), Hedgerow Cranesbill (Geranium pyrenaicum), Wood Avens (Geum urbanum), Greater Yellow-rattle (Rhinanthus angustifolius), Stinking Hellebore (Helleborus foetidus), White Flax (Linum perenne), Ox-eye Daisy (Leucanthemum vulgare), Greater Masterwort (Astrantia major), Woodruff (Galium odoratum), Tuberous comfrey (Symphytum tuberosum), Great Spotted Woodpecker (Pico Picapinos / Dendrocopos major), Firecrest (Reyezuelo Listado / Regulus ignicapillus), Robin (Petirrojo Europeo / Erithacus rubecula), Common Redstart (Colirroja Real / Phoenicurus phoenicurus), Coal (Carbonero Garrapinos / Parus ater) and Great Tit (Carbonera Común / Parus major), Red-billed Chough (Chova Piquirroja / Pyrrhocorax pyrrhocorax) and Common Chaffinch (Pinzón Vulgar / Fringilla coelebs).
